This week on Rail Talk! It’s our most highly-anticipated episode yet, featuring the great debate between Mike Repole and Tinky aka Tony Cobitz. This conflict has been simmering on horse racing Twitter for months, and the two agreed to get in the ring together for a verbal showdown on our podcast. No topic is off limits, as the outspoken billionaire owner and self-proclaimed commissioner of racing squares off against the industry veteran and pseudonymous online critic.Subjects covered include: the durability of the modern racehorse, shuttered racetracks, potential changes to the Breeders’ Cup, marketing the game, improving the product for horseplayers, HISA, stallion mare caps and much, much more. There’s plenty of animosity and feistiness, but also areas of agreement, understanding and even the potential to work together as a result of this debate.
